John 6:13

Therefore they gathered [them] together
The several broken bits of bread, which lay about upon the grass, which the people had left, after they had been sufficiently refreshed:

and filled twelve baskets;
every disciple had a basket filled:

with the fragments of the five barley loaves;
and it may be of the fishes also:

which remained over and above unto them that had eaten;
such a marvellous increase was there, through the power of Christ going along with them; insomuch that they multiplied to such a degree, either in the hands of the distributors, or of the eaters.
